In the contemporary fast-moving consumer goods (FMCG) market, the shopping trolley has evolved from a simple product carrier to a vital touchpoint in user experience and operations. Modern grocery fleets require high structural integrity, ergonomic stability, and noise-minimizing castor technology to support longer shopping cycles and prevent customer fatigue.
As retailers scale globally, custom procurement processes must balance payload durability with localized configurations. Material selections now range from standard wire meshes with protective clear coatings to hybrid structures incorporating food-grade Polypropylene (PP) and lightweight aluminum. Selecting the right cart configuration directly impacts inventory throughput, floor management, and long-term capital expenditure efficiency.

We prioritize quality control through every stage of production. Our facility maintains a quality management system certified under ISO9001 and SGS standards, overseen by 22 certified quality technicians.
We perform tensile strength testing on incoming Q235 steel wires to verify load capacities. During production, 3D laser-welding monitors check joints for penetration depth and weld integrity. Each trolley batch undergoes salt spray corrosion testing and load-simulation tests up to 1.5 times the rated payload capacity before shipping.
Different regional retail formats require customized equipment sizes, configurations, and materials to match local shopper habits and store layouts.
Designed for large store footprints and wide aisles, North American carts prioritize high volume capacities (180L to 250L) and double-basket layouts. Built-in cup holders, child safety seating, and high-impact corner bumpers protect store fixtures during high-payload use.
European designs focus on space optimization, nesting depth, and pedestrian-friendly paths. Carts features coin locks, quiet polyurethane running castors, and compact footprints (75L to 130L) that maneuver easily on travelators and fit within narrow store aisles.
Asian retail spaces benefit from lightweight, multi-tiered wire baskets or hybrid plastic-steel carts with load capacities ranging from 50kg to 130kg. These designs allow shoppers to stack multiple baskets in a single footprint, optimizing limited aisle space.
We track and integrate emerging retail technologies, moving toward connected, sustainable, and automated checkout solutions.
We are replacing virgin plastics with up to 50% post-consumer recycled (PCR) Polypropylene in our non-structural cart accessories, and optimizing handle shapes to reduce muscle strain.
We are testing smart castors with magnetic locking systems and embedded RFID tags to prevent theft and help store managers track cart usage and distribution on-site.
We are developing modular cart frame designs that accommodate tablet mounts, barcode scanners, and weighing sensors to support automated, scan-and-go self-checkout workflows.
Ningbo FutureSpace exports products to international markets by adhering to regional quality standards. Our wire-forming and assembly processes follow EN 1929 European standards, which dictate safety requirements and testing protocols for shopping trolleys.
